laforge has submitted this change. ( 
https://gerrit.osmocom.org/c/osmo-bsc/+/27630 )

Change subject: doc/examples: add a confmerge file with example hopping 
parameters
......................................................................

doc/examples: add a confmerge file with example hopping parameters

This file was taken from docker-playground.git, and this is basically
what we use when running the ttcn3-bts-test with hopping enabled.

Change-Id: I205eb53901e06ee52dc64e050cfe2374cb9c771e
---
M doc/examples/Makefile.am
A doc/examples/osmo-bsc/osmo-bsc-4trx-fh.confmerge
2 files changed, 217 insertions(+), 1 deletion(-)

Approvals:
  Jenkins Builder: Verified
  pespin: Looks good to me, but someone else must approve
  laforge: Looks good to me, approved



diff --git a/doc/examples/Makefile.am b/doc/examples/Makefile.am
index 9d8cd75..c25ebc5 100644
--- a/doc/examples/Makefile.am
+++ b/doc/examples/Makefile.am
@@ -6,7 +6,7 @@

 EXTRA_DIST = $(OSMOCONF_FILES)

-CFG_FILES = find $(srcdir) -name '*.cfg*' | sed -e 's,^$(srcdir),,'
+CFG_FILES = find $(srcdir) -name '*.cfg*' -o -name '*.confmerge*' | sed -e 
's,^$(srcdir),,'

 dist-hook:
        for f in $$($(CFG_FILES)); do \
diff --git a/doc/examples/osmo-bsc/osmo-bsc-4trx-fh.confmerge 
b/doc/examples/osmo-bsc/osmo-bsc-4trx-fh.confmerge
new file mode 100644
index 0000000..0a14631
--- /dev/null
+++ b/doc/examples/osmo-bsc/osmo-bsc-4trx-fh.confmerge
@@ -0,0 +1,216 @@
+! This is a confmerge file with example frequency hopping parameters.
+! Use the osmo-config-merge tool to apply it to osmo-bsc-4trx.cfg.
+network
+ bts 0
+  trx 0
+   timeslot 0
+    ! Shall not be hopping
+   timeslot 1
+    ! Intentionally non-hopping
+   timeslot 2
+    ! (c) HSN=2, MAIO=0,1
+    hopping enabled 1
+    hopping sequence-number 2
+    hopping maio 0
+    hopping arfcn add 871
+    hopping arfcn add 873
+   timeslot 3
+    ! (e) HSN=3, MAIO=3,2,1,0
+    hopping enabled 1
+    hopping sequence-number 3
+    hopping maio 3
+    hopping arfcn add 871
+    hopping arfcn add 873
+    hopping arfcn add 875
+    hopping arfcn add 877
+   timeslot 4
+    ! Intentionally non-hopping
+   timeslot 5
+    ! (f) HSN=5, MAIO=0,1,2,3
+    hopping enabled 1
+    hopping sequence-number 5
+    hopping maio 0
+    hopping arfcn add 871
+    hopping arfcn add 873
+    hopping arfcn add 875
+    hopping arfcn add 877
+   timeslot 6
+    ! (g) HSN=6, MAIO=1,0
+    hopping enabled 1
+    hopping sequence-number 6
+    hopping maio 1
+    hopping arfcn add 871
+    hopping arfcn add 877
+   timeslot 7
+    ! (i) HSN=0, MAIO=1,3
+    hopping enabled 1
+    hopping sequence-number 0
+    hopping maio 1
+    hopping arfcn add 871
+    hopping arfcn add 875
+  trx 1
+   timeslot 0
+    ! (a) HSN=0, MAIO=0,1,2
+    hopping enabled 1
+    hopping sequence-number 0
+    hopping maio 0
+    hopping arfcn add 873
+    hopping arfcn add 875
+    hopping arfcn add 877
+   timeslot 1
+    ! Intentionally non-hopping
+   timeslot 2
+    ! (c) HSN=2, MAIO=0,1
+    hopping enabled 1
+    hopping sequence-number 2
+    hopping maio 1
+    hopping arfcn add 871
+    hopping arfcn add 873
+   timeslot 3
+    ! (e) HSN=3, MAIO=3,2,1,0
+    hopping enabled 1
+    hopping sequence-number 3
+    hopping maio 2
+    hopping arfcn add 871
+    hopping arfcn add 873
+    hopping arfcn add 875
+    hopping arfcn add 877
+   timeslot 4
+    ! Intentionally non-hopping
+   timeslot 5
+    ! (f) HSN=5, MAIO=0,1,2,3
+    hopping enabled 1
+    hopping sequence-number 5
+    hopping maio 1
+    hopping arfcn add 871
+    hopping arfcn add 873
+    hopping arfcn add 875
+    hopping arfcn add 877
+   timeslot 6
+    ! (h) HSN=6, MAIO=1,0
+    hopping enabled 1
+    hopping sequence-number 6
+    hopping maio 1
+    hopping arfcn add 873
+    hopping arfcn add 875
+   timeslot 7
+    ! (j) HSN=0, MAIO=0,2
+    hopping enabled 1
+    hopping sequence-number 0
+    hopping maio 0
+    hopping arfcn add 873
+    hopping arfcn add 877
+  trx 2
+   timeslot 0
+    ! (a) HSN=0, MAIO=0,1,2
+    hopping enabled 1
+    hopping sequence-number 0
+    hopping maio 1
+    hopping arfcn add 873
+    hopping arfcn add 875
+    hopping arfcn add 877
+   timeslot 1
+    ! (b) HSN=1, MAIO=3,5
+    hopping enabled 1
+    hopping sequence-number 1
+    hopping maio 3
+    hopping arfcn add 875
+    hopping arfcn add 877
+   timeslot 2
+    ! (d) HSN=2, MAIO=2,3
+    hopping enabled 1
+    hopping sequence-number 2
+    hopping maio 2
+    hopping arfcn add 875
+    hopping arfcn add 877
+   timeslot 3
+    ! (e) HSN=3, MAIO=3,2,1,0
+    hopping enabled 1
+    hopping sequence-number 3
+    hopping maio 1
+    hopping arfcn add 871
+    hopping arfcn add 873
+    hopping arfcn add 875
+    hopping arfcn add 877
+   timeslot 4
+    ! Intentionally non-hopping
+   timeslot 5
+    ! (f) HSN=5, MAIO=0,1,2,3
+    hopping enabled 1
+    hopping sequence-number 5
+    hopping maio 2
+    hopping arfcn add 871
+    hopping arfcn add 873
+    hopping arfcn add 875
+    hopping arfcn add 877
+   timeslot 6
+    ! (h) HSN=6, MAIO=1,0
+    hopping enabled 1
+    hopping sequence-number 6
+    hopping maio 0
+    hopping arfcn add 873
+    hopping arfcn add 875
+   timeslot 7
+    ! (i) HSN=0, MAIO=1,3
+    hopping enabled 1
+    hopping sequence-number 0
+    hopping maio 3
+    hopping arfcn add 871
+    hopping arfcn add 875
+  trx 3
+   timeslot 0
+    ! (a) HSN=0, MAIO=0,1,2
+    hopping enabled 1
+    hopping sequence-number 0
+    hopping maio 2
+    hopping arfcn add 873
+    hopping arfcn add 875
+    hopping arfcn add 877
+   timeslot 1
+    ! (b) HSN=1, MAIO=3,5
+    hopping enabled 1
+    hopping sequence-number 1
+    hopping maio 5
+    hopping arfcn add 875
+    hopping arfcn add 877
+   timeslot 2
+    ! (d) HSN=2, MAIO=2,3
+    hopping enabled 1
+    hopping sequence-number 2
+    hopping maio 3
+    hopping arfcn add 875
+    hopping arfcn add 877
+   timeslot 3
+    ! (e) HSN=3, MAIO=3,2,1,0
+    hopping enabled 1
+    hopping sequence-number 3
+    hopping maio 0
+    hopping arfcn add 871
+    hopping arfcn add 873
+    hopping arfcn add 875
+    hopping arfcn add 877
+   timeslot 4
+    ! Intentionally non-hopping
+   timeslot 5
+    ! (f) HSN=5, MAIO=0,1,2,3
+    hopping enabled 1
+    hopping sequence-number 5
+    hopping maio 3
+    hopping arfcn add 871
+    hopping arfcn add 873
+    hopping arfcn add 875
+    hopping arfcn add 877
+   timeslot 6
+    ! (g) HSN=6, MAIO=1,0
+    hopping enabled 1
+    hopping sequence-number 6
+    hopping maio 0
+    hopping arfcn add 871
+    hopping arfcn add 877
+   timeslot 7
+    ! (j) HSN=0, MAIO=0,2
+    hopping enabled 1
+    hopping sequence-number 0
+    hopping maio 2
+    hopping arfcn add 873
+    hopping arfcn add 877

--
To view, visit https://gerrit.osmocom.org/c/osmo-bsc/+/27630
To unsubscribe, or for help writing mail filters, visit 
https://gerrit.osmocom.org/settings

Gerrit-Project: osmo-bsc
Gerrit-Branch: master
Gerrit-Change-Id: I205eb53901e06ee52dc64e050cfe2374cb9c771e
Gerrit-Change-Number: 27630
Gerrit-PatchSet: 1
Gerrit-Owner: fixeria <vyanits...@sysmocom.de>
Gerrit-Reviewer: Jenkins Builder
Gerrit-Reviewer: laforge <lafo...@osmocom.org>
Gerrit-Reviewer: pespin <pes...@sysmocom.de>
Gerrit-MessageType: merged

Reply via email to